Description:
Obverse
In the upper part, from left to right, the face value "10 LEI", Romania's coat of arms and the inscription "ROMANIA", separated by a vertical row of bi-pyramidal necklace parts as the ones found in the Hinova hoard; below, two horizontal rows of bi-pyramidal necklace parts and the year of issue - 2008.
Reverse
In the upper part, from left to right, a vertical row of four bell-shaped necklace parts, the inscription "TEZAURUL" written from bottom to top, a vertical row of three bi-pyramidal necklace parts, the horizontal inscription on two rows "DE LA HINOVA" and the cylindrical open muff - the most important item of the Hinova hoard; below, two horizontal rows of bi-pyramidal necklace parts.
